Hearst Castle

Hearst Castle is a grand estate located in California, built by newspaper magnate William Randolph Hearst in the early 20th century. It features opulent architecture, luxurious furnishings, and expansive gardens, reflecting a mix of Mediterranean and European styles. The castle served as a private retreat for Hearst and hosted many famous guests. Today, it’s a historic National Historic Landmark managed by the California State Parks, offering guided tours that showcase its art collections, impressive pools, and breathtaking views of the coast. Hearst Castle stands as a symbol of early 20th-century opulence and American history.
